On May 1, 2026, two historic businesses, Quiz Clothing and Routledges the Bakers, collapsed into administration. This event underscores the severe challenges facing the retail sector.

Quiz Clothing, which has operated for 33 years, owes approximately £40 million. The company has 40 stores across the UK and seven concessions in Ireland, employing 565 staff members.

As of midday Tuesday, Quiz Clothing’s administrators are from Interpath. They expect the administration trading period to last until mid-May 2026.

Routledges the Bakers has been in business for nearly 109 years. It cited rising operational costs and a financial shortfall of nearly £779,000 as reasons for its closure.

Within hours of going into liquidation, Routledges closed all its branches across Carlisle. The bakery’s long history ended abruptly with this decision.

The collapse of these companies reflects a broader trend in retail. Rising costs and financial instability continue to challenge many businesses in this sector.

The impact on employees is significant. Quiz Clothing announced 109 redundancies at its head office and distribution center following its administration announcement.
